Description:
Flagentyl Tablets contain Secnidazole, an antiparasitic and antibacterial agent used to treat infections caused by anaerobic bacteria and protozoa. It is commonly prescribed for conditions like bacterial vaginosis, trichomoniasis, and amoebiasis.

Dosage:
- Typically, 500 mg to 2 g as a single dose or divided doses depending on the infection.
- Dosage varies based on the condition being treated; follow the healthcare provider’s advice.
Therapeutic Category:
- Antiprotozoal and Antibacterial Agent.
Active Ingredients/Composition:
- Secnidazole: 500 mg per tablet.

Directions/Usage:
- Take the tablet by mouth with water, preferably after a meal.
- Complete the full prescribed course, even if symptoms improve early.
- Follow the prescribed dosage schedule for optimal effectiveness.
Common Side Effects:
- Nausea or vomiting.
- Metallic taste in the mouth.
- Diarrhea or abdominal discomfort.
- Dizziness or headache.
- Allergic reactions (rash, itching, or swelling—rare).

Safety Advice:
- Do not consume alcohol during treatment and for at least 48 hours after the last dose to avoid a disulfiram-like reaction (flushing, nausea, or vomiting).
- Avoid use if allergic to Secnidazole or related medications.
- Consult a doctor if pregnant, breastfeeding, or taking other medications.
- Discontinue use and seek medical advice if severe side effects or allergic reactions occur.
